At Idé-Pro, we use injection moulding and high pressure die casting to produce prototypes in the right process and material without compromising on quality. The function, properties and finish are therefore exactly the same as in the finished product and our prototypes can therefore be used for e.g. start-up production and tested for wear, transport and sales potential before investing in a large production apparatus for final production.
We specialise in injection moulding plastic prototypes and with our large capacity of injection moulding machines, we can mould plastic parts from 0.01g up to 41.5 kg with a clamping force from 6T up to 4000T. Therefore, we can produce plastic prototypes regardless of size, construction and plastic type.
For injection moulding prototypes, we manufacture many aluminium tools, which is faster and less costly than traditional moulding tools.
Delivery time usually: 3 - 6 weeks
(Large and complex items up to 10-12 weeks)
With high-pressure die-casting, we produce functional prototypes in aluminium, magnesium and zinc in tools designed for prototype production. We have a high capacity in the foundry and can produce prototypes up to 21.8kg with a clamping force of up to 1350T.
The prototypes have the same properties as series-produced parts and can be used directly in the final design, for crash testing and start-up production.
Delivery time usually: 5 - 8 weeks
(Large and complex parts up to 12 - 14 weeks)

For projects where prototypes need to be produced in smaller quantities, we also offer 3D printing, investment casting and machined from block. These methods do not require tooling and therefore have lower start-up costs.
For jobs that require fast turnaround, we can 3D print prototypes in wax with extremely high detail, which is used for plaster moulding.
We also offer 3D printing when product development is finalised before we start tooling. For 3D printing we use SLS, FDM and SLA.
Delivery time: 1 - 5 days
This process is perfect for efficiently prototyping aluminium and zinc in small quantities. Investment casting does not use moulding tools, so the process has very low start-up costs.
We typically recommend investment casting for complex parts and offer full design freedom. The method is ideal at the beginning of the development phase, for the production of the first prototypes and is a great way to get started quickly.
Delivery time: 1 - 2 weeks
In our state-of-the-art CNC department, we offer this method, where light metal prototypes are milled directly from the block.
As with investment casting, this method does not require a moulding tool and therefore has low start-up costs. Therefore, it's perfect for complicated parts with fine tolerances, very small quantities, and dropout samples.
Delivery time: 1 - 2 weeks

Idé-Pro's prototypes are moulded in the same process and the same material as the finished product, giving identical strength, finish and function – unlike 3D-printed prototypes, which often differ in mechanical properties and surface quality. This means Idé-Pro's prototypes can be tested authentically under real-world conditions, such as crash testing or wear testing, and can be used directly in start-up production.
3D printing, on the other hand, is faster and cheaper for very early-stage design validation, where functional testing is not critical.

Rapid prototyping is a method for the fast production of functional prototypes, enabling products to be tested and validated early in the development process. At Idé-Pro, we offer rapid prototyping through our Fast Track concept, where injection moulded and high pressure die cast prototypes are delivered with an exceptionally short lead time.
Fast Track prototypes in plastic are delivered in 1–3 weeks, while Fast Track prototypes in light metal are delivered in 3–5 weeks, depending on size and complexity. An approved 3D CAD file is a prerequisite for starting a Fast Track project. The concept is designed for projects with tight deadlines or a need for fast product testing.

Idé-Pro is certified by Force Certification under ISO 9001 for the development and production of injection moulded plastic, die cast light metal and moulded EPS and EPP parts, and under ISO 14001 and ISO 50001 for environmental and energy management. Idé-Pro is also enrolled in the Operation Clean Sweep programme to reduce plastic pellet loss into the environment.
